[Scummvm-cvs-logs] CVS: scummvm/dists/msvc7 scummvm.vcproj,1.34,1.35

Eugene Sandulenko sev at users.sourceforge.net
Fri Nov 5 17:46:39 CET 2004


Update of /cvsroot/scummvm/scummvm/dists/msvc7
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v27409/dists/msvc7

Modified Files:
	scummvm.vcproj 
Log Message:
Major MT-32 emu overhaul based on KingGuppy's code.
 o added configure option
 o mi2 intro doesn't freeze anymore and has no sound glitches
 o missing instruments in many titles are fixed
 o numerous memory overwrite bugs are fixed
 o code is cleaned a lot and splitted into many smaller files
 o mt32.cpp went to backends/midi
 o synced with upstream code
 o reverberation fixed

 * don't complain about File class wrapper :)
 * all custom types are back
 * #pragmas are to do
 * maybe some indentation is wrong too

I prefer smaller commits, but this thing came in one piece.


Index: scummvm.vcproj
===================================================================
RCS file: /cvsroot/scummvm/scummvm/dists/msvc7/scummvm.vcproj,v
retrieving revision 1.34
retrieving revision 1.35
diff -u -d -r1.34 -r1.35
--- scummvm.vcproj	23 Oct 2004 13:46:20 -0000	1.34
+++ scummvm.vcproj	6 Nov 2004 01:41:31 -0000	1.35
@@ -461,6 +461,9 @@
 					RelativePath="..\..\backends\midi\adlib.cpp">
 				</File>
 				<File
+					RelativePath="..\..\backends\midi\mt32.cpp">
+				</File>
+				<File
 					RelativePath="..\..\backends\midi\null.cpp">
 				</File>
 				<File
@@ -472,13 +475,25 @@
 				<Filter
 					Name="mt32">
 					<File
-						RelativePath="..\..\backends\midi\mt32\freeverb.cpp">
+						RelativePath="..\..\backends\midi\mt32\file.cpp">
 					</File>
 					<File
-						RelativePath="..\..\backends\midi\mt32\freeverb.h">
+						RelativePath="..\..\backends\midi\mt32\file.h">
 					</File>
 					<File
-						RelativePath="..\..\backends\midi\mt32\mt32.cpp">
+						RelativePath="..\..\backends\midi\mt32\i386.cpp">
+					</File>
+					<File
+						RelativePath="..\..\backends\midi\mt32\i386.h">
+					</File>
+					<File
+						RelativePath="..\..\backends\midi\mt32\mt32emu.h">
+					</File>
+					<File
+						RelativePath="..\..\backends\midi\mt32\part.cpp">
+					</File>
+					<File
+						RelativePath="..\..\backends\midi\mt32\part.h">
 					</File>
 					<File
 						RelativePath="..\..\backends\midi\mt32\partial.cpp">
@@ -487,6 +502,12 @@
 						RelativePath="..\..\backends\midi\mt32\partial.h">
 					</File>
 					<File
+						RelativePath="..\..\backends\midi\mt32\partialManager.cpp">
+					</File>
+					<File
+						RelativePath="..\..\backends\midi\mt32\partialManager.h">
+					</File>
+					<File
 						RelativePath="..\..\backends\midi\mt32\structures.h">
 					</File>
 					<File
@@ -495,6 +516,39 @@
 					<File
 						RelativePath="..\..\backends\midi\mt32\synth.h">
 					</File>
+					<File
+						RelativePath="..\..\backends\midi\mt32\tables.cpp">
+					</File>
+					<File
+						RelativePath="..\..\backends\midi\mt32\tables.h">
+					</File>
+					<Filter
+						Name="freeverb">
+						<File
+							RelativePath="..\..\backends\midi\mt32\freeverb\allpass.cpp">
+						</File>
+						<File
+							RelativePath="..\..\backends\midi\mt32\freeverb\allpass.h">
+						</File>
+						<File
+							RelativePath="..\..\backends\midi\mt32\freeverb\comb.cpp">
+						</File>
+						<File
+							RelativePath="..\..\backends\midi\mt32\freeverb\comb.h">
+						</File>
+						<File
+							RelativePath="..\..\backends\midi\mt32\freeverb\denormals.h">
+						</File>
+						<File
+							RelativePath="..\..\backends\midi\mt32\freeverb\revmodel.cpp">
+						</File>
+						<File
+							RelativePath="..\..\backends\midi\mt32\freeverb\revmodel.h">
+						</File>
+						<File
+							RelativePath="..\..\backends\midi\mt32\freeverb\tuning.h">
+						</File>
+					</Filter>
 				</Filter>
 			</Filter>
 		</Filter>





More information about the Scummvm-git-logs mailing list